优化
-
亲历!给大龄IT人的几点求职建议
导读:这是一份中年IT人下岗再就业指南,一个43岁下岗,面试了15家公司,重新就业的大龄IT男分享的求职故事和感悟。 人到中年,有时很难做到从容仰望星空。当你一次次的在你最自…
-
你应该(或许)没使用过的 3 种 Python 模板语言
包括这 3 个模板语言在内,Python 积累了许多模板语言。 当需要使用模板语言来编写 Python Web 应用时,有很多健壮的解决方案。 有 Jinja2、Genshi 和 …
-
从构建关系网到面试最后一问,这是一份AI公司应聘全面指南
21cto导读:对于毕业生来说,面试是进入社会的一个重要历程。本文中,Aman Dalmia 介绍了面向广大 AI 公司应聘的各种注意事项,包括如何制作简历、GitHub 和领英资…
-
大话后端开发的奇淫技巧大集合
导读:本文作者多年来在后端开发过程中总结沉淀下来的经验和设计思路分享模块化设计 根据业务场景,将业务抽离成独立模块,对外通过接口提供服务,减少系统复杂度和耦合度,实现可复用,易维护…
-
微服务之基于Docker的分布式企业级实践
前言 基于 Docker 的容器技术是在2015年的时候开始接触的,两年多的时间,作为一名 Docker 的 DevOps,也见证了 Docker 的技术体系的快速发展。本文主要是…
-
如何实现高容量大并发数据库服务 | 数据库分布式架构设计
编辑推荐:本文来自于sohu,介绍了为什么要做分布式数据库架构改造?分布式数据库架构改造,如何做?水平拆分的难点及解决方案等知识。 摘要 数据库拆分要根据业务现状、模式,选择合…
-
对构建系统进行容器化的指南
搭建一个通过容器分发应用的可复用系统可能很复杂,但这儿有个好方法。 一个用于将源代码转换成可运行的应用的构建系统是由工具和流程共同组成。在转换过程中还涉及到代码的受众从软件开发者转…
-
秒杀系统架构之实践
前言 之前在 Java-Interview 中提到过秒杀架构的设计,这次基于其中的理论简单实现了一下。 本次采用循序渐进的方式逐步提高性能达到并发秒杀的效果,文章较长请准备好瓜子…
-
正念程序员:修习与完善自己的工作流程
21CTO社区导读:作为程序员,我们相信新的语言和框架可以提高我们的工作效率。但我们如何做也很重要,本文为实践篇。 作为程序员,我们学习和使用新的开发框架和语言可以提高生产力…
-
程序猿月薪过 7 万,可以落户北京了!
这些年,北京几乎聚集了中国数量最多顶尖的创业公司和创投机构,从 IDG 资本、红杉中国、经纬创投到百度、京东、美团、今日头条……浩浩荡荡数十万人。这一纸新规有望让他们落地生根。 春…